Article summary:

1. A new onboard air curtain dust control method is proposed to reduce dust pollution in longwall mines.

2. The Euler-Lagrange model is used to simulate the dust diffusion characteristics with and without air curtain.

3. The results show that two high-speed air curtains form on both sides of the working area of the shearer driver, reducing the dust concentration in the working area by 69.40%.
